You're talking about one division, and a division that has historically been fairly shallow, and technically poor. The premier weight classes have seen that evolution; although, I think some of the grappling in MMA is getting weaker as fighters seek the quick win, and big payday.

Here's the reality: Big guys don't tend make great technical fighters. They rely too much on size, and strength in a division that can get carnival like with the size differences. Even the most skilled HW's often tend to be awkward, with poor gas tanks. It's the smaller HW's that tend to do better.

Fedor was an undersized HW, and it actually benefited him in what is a clumsy division. It's not easy to carry size, and create such high output while dealing with the unpredictability of a fight, and guys that hit hard.

It's not terrible right now, but don't ever expect it to be a murderers row like the lower weight classes.

185, 170, 155, 145 will always be the premier weight classes for MMA because they contain the more reasonably sized fighters.
